With every change in a system (e.g. phase transformation, chemical reactions), heat is either absorbed or released. This can be analysed quantitatively using differential scanning calorimetry. We can use a DSC 204 F1 Phoenix from Netzsch to measure cooling and heating processes from approx. -50 to 600 °C. The cooling and heating rates can be set from 0.1 to 100 K•min−1 .
